Understanding the Threatening Aura
Causes of Fear and Anxiety
The threatening aura often stems from various sources, including:
- Past Traumas: Negative experiences from the past can leave lasting imprints on the mind, leading to a fear of recurrence.
- Societal Expectations: High expectations from family, friends, and society can create immense pressure, resulting in anxiety.
- Perfectionism: The desire to be perfect can lead to self-doubt and fear of failure.
- Lack of Self-Esteem: Low self-esteem can make individuals more susceptible to negative thoughts and fears.
Symptoms of Fear and Anxiety
Recognizing the symptoms of fear and anxiety is crucial for addressing them effectively. Common symptoms include:
- Physical Symptoms: Increased heart rate, sweating, trembling, and nausea.
- Emotional Symptoms: Feelings of dread, panic, and helplessness.
- Behavioral Symptoms: Avoidance of certain situations, social withdrawal, and procrastination.
Strategies for Overcoming the Threatening Aura
1. Self-Awareness
The first step in overcoming the threatening aura is to become aware of your thoughts, feelings, and behaviors. Mindfulness practices, such as meditation and journaling, can help you gain insight into your inner world.
# Meditation Example
1. Find a quiet and comfortable place to sit.
2. Close your eyes and take slow, deep breaths.
3. Focus on your breath and observe any thoughts or sensations that arise without judgment.
4. Return your focus to your breath when your mind wanders.
5. Continue for 10-15 minutes.
2.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T)
CBT is a widely recognized and effective treatment for anxiety and fear. It involves identifying and challenging negative thought patterns and replacing them with more rational and positive ones.
3. Positive Affirmations
Positive affirmations can help shift your mindset and reduce the impact of negative thoughts. Repeat affirmations such as “I am capable of overcoming my fears” and “I am worthy of success” daily.
4. Building Self-Esteem
Engage in activities that boost your self-esteem, such as:
- Set Achievable Goals: Set realistic goals and celebrate your achievements, no matter how small.
- Practice Self-Compassion: Be kind to yourself and acknowledge your strengths and weaknesses.
- Surround Yourself with Support: Seek support from friends, family, or a therapist.
5. Developing Resilience
Resilience is the ability to bounce back from adversity. To build resilience:
- Learn from Failure: Analyze what went wrong and how you can improve.
- Practice Mindfulness: Stay present and focus on the present moment.
- Seek Help: Don’t hesitate to ask for help when needed.
